IPL 2025 Points Table updated after DC vs RCB: Royal Challengers Bengaluru goes top, Mumbai Indians jumps to third

IPL 2025 Points Table updated after DC vs RCB: Royal Challengers Bengaluru goes top, Mumbai Indians jumps to third

Royal Challengers Bengaluru moved to the top of the Indian Premier League 2025 points table after its six-wicket victory over Delhi Capitals on Sunday.

The Rajat Patidar-led side now has 14 points from 10 games, and has won all its six games away from home this season.

Earlier on Sunday, Mumbai Indians thrashed Lucknow Super Giants by 54 runs at the Wankhede Stadium to climb to third. It is level on points with Gujarat Titans, but is one spot behind due to inferior Net Run Rate.
